在M上运行S3命令时获取“/usr/local/opt/python/bin/python2.7:错误的解释器:没有这样的文件或directo”

2024-09-30 06:12:27 发布

您现在位置:Python中文网/ 问答频道 /正文

我用的是Mac High Sierra。我正在尝试安装Amazon的s3cli工具。我以为我已经通过pip安装成功了,但是后来我在运行s3命令时遇到了这个错误。。。在

localhost:~ davea$ s3cmd --recursive ls s3://sbdasset.springboardonline.com | grep "resource"
-bash: /usr/local/bin/s3cmd: /usr/local/opt/python/bin/python2.7: bad interpreter: No such file or directory

根据这里的答案--pip installation /usr/local/opt/python/bin/python2.7: bad interpreter: No such file or directory,我尝试了推荐。。。在

^{pr2}$

但是,我重新运行了上面的命令,得到了同样的错误。那篇文章里的其他答案都不起作用。我还需要检查安装来让Amazon的s3cli工具正常工作吗?在


Tags: pip工具no命令amazonbins3usr
1条回答
网友
1楼 · 发布于 2024-09-30 06:12:27

尝试打开一个新终端并运行s3cmd,如果不工作,可能会丢失env变量,请执行以下操作之一: 尝试重新安装python

brew install python@2

或者安装Python https://www.anaconda.com/distribution/#macos 然后打开一个新的终端窗口,再试一次,它应该可以工作了

相关问题 更多 >

    热门问题